Saturday, December 15, 2007 - This wine has a big, rich nose of dark fruit and some oak. The color was deep, deep ruby as I would have expected from a Shiraz from Oz. The wine was decanted for a couple of hours before the first taste which I'm guessing did it a great service. By the time we got around to tasting, the mouthfeel was silky and rich. Currant, some oak and toffee were noticed. We received as a gift whiich made it all the better.
